America biography
Three sons of military men whose fathers were stationed in England in the early 1950s, at the United States Air Force installation at RAF West Ruislip, London, and whose mothers were English, all happened to be back in England in the mid-1960s and all three attended London Central High School, about 16 miles Northwest of London, where they met while playing in two different bands.
- The three were:
- Gerry Beckley-born September 12, 1952, in Fort Worth, Texas.
- Dewey Bunnell-born January 19, 1951, in Harrogate, Yorkshire, England.
- Dan Peek-born November 1, 1950, in Panama City, Florida.
They decided to start their own band that was initially called, Daze. However, while trying to think of a different name for the band, they saw an old jukebox with the name "Americana" written on it. It made them think about how much they'd like to go back to America and thus the band named AMERICA was born in 1969.
